Output 9661fc04692963dfc80d085a79485d9bc6c2018c4cec57042924f080846f808d:93
- value
- 75425490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86016631580d55dcab6fa95b266b18a7d2ebf6f2 OP_EQUAL
- address
- 3Dua9U1WZ4KuvDkKDAgyP5WFcnNzHVuWqD
- transaction
- 9661fc04692963dfc80d085a79485d9bc6c2018c4cec57042924f080846f808d
- confirmations
- 343042
- spent
- true